

Surachai Leerungruang dedicated his life to mastering the craft of steel manufacturing.
“Respect the material.
Master the process.
Never compromise on quality.”
In the 1950s, Surachai began his journey as a young entrepreneur with a passion for making things. As a young man, Surachai learned welding, fabrication, and engineering in a small workshop producing fan stands from steel.
Steel fascinated him.
It was practical, durable, and honest.


Inspired by what steel could become, he began importing steel pipes and crafting chairs, tables, and cabinets by hand. What started as a small operation gradually became a collection of steel furniture.
Demand grew.
Workshops became factories.
Factories became industries.

Surachai's understanding of steel continued to deepen. Driven by curiosity and a desire to improve, Surachai travelled to Japan — encountering new manufacturing technologies, production methods, and quality standards that would shape everything that followed.
Over the years, our factories manufactured millions of products, serving homes, offices, institutions, and businesses throughout Thailand and abroad.


Among the many ventures that emerged throughout this journey was LEECO.
“Lee” — from the family name.
“Co” — from company.
Together, LEECO became a symbol of trust, quality, and expertise built through decades of working with steel.
